French Fries


Ingredients:

Potato (meant for baking) – 5
Chilly Powder – 1 tsp
Salt – to taste
Cooking Oil








Cooking Instructions:

Clean and wash the potatoes well and peel off the skin and cut into our finger size thickness and height. Soak the cut potatoes into cold water for about 15 minutes. After that drain the excess water, and let it to cook in hot water until the potatoes are 40% cooked and not more than that. Again drain the excess water and pat it dry with the kitchen towel.



Now heat oil in a deep pan and the oil should be very hot to fry potatoes. Deep fry the potato strips in batches and cook until it turns golden brown. Repeat the process for all the potato strips.







Let the potatoes to come to room temperature and then toss it with require amount of salt and chilly powder and serve it.
